在tomcat的conf/Catalina/localhost文件下新建temp.xml
在temp.xml 中添加<Context path="/temp" docBase="D:\Users\suyl\test" debug="0"></Context>
启动tomcat,访问 http://localhost:8880/temp/2d128fb8-5134-48ca-9e7e-8d96448c8d2e.txt 即可访问到
tomcat如何配置文件目录映射有的时候我们希望达到这样的目的
通过htto://localhost:8080/img/1.img来访问到我们某个文件目录下的img目录下的1.img
在网上查找了一下资料发现可以这样做
如果是tomcat的话可以这样设置
首先在tomcat的根目录下找到\conf\Catalina\localhost,你会发现里面有一些你的项目的xml配置文件
在这里我们要写一个简单的xml配置文件
<Context docBase="e:/" path="/img" reloadable="true">
</Context>
其中
path 则是访问路径,即你的用网址方式去访问的路径
docBase 表示映射文件夹路径,即你的机器下的文件路径
保存的名字应该为你的path去掉/即img.xml(注意一定要根据你的path命名,否则不起作用)。
只需要编辑%tomcathome%\conf\server.xml文件,在标签中增加如何代码即可:<Context docBase="D:/autotest_file/local/report" path="/report" debug="0" reloadable="true" />
其中docBase属性指定的为文件实际存储路径,path属性指定的为文件访问路径;如在浏览器中访问http://localhost/autotest/report/report.html实际指向的文件地址为D:/autotest_file/local/report/report.html
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)